I agree, vi and vim have a very steep learning curve. And it took me years before I ditched nano or joe for vim.

But once you are you used to it, you will love it. It's so powerful and extendible!

If you want to learn vim, run vimtutor on the commandline, it's part of the vim package.

Or follow the online interactive Vim tutorial.

Good luck!

PS: :x is short for :wq. ;) ZZ in command mode is even shorter.
